Immerse yourself in the serene majesty of Auronzo Lake, nestled in the heart of the Dolomites. This tranquil cycling journey offers spectacular turquoise waters framed by towering alpine peaks and lush forests, creating a soul-soothing outdoor adventure. Feel the cool mountain breeze as you pedal along scenic trails, embraced by nature's untouched beauty. Perfect for travelers seeking a refreshing escape into Italy's pristine landscapes, this ride invites you to breathe deeply, connect with nature, and discover a hidden gem where every moment is pure tranquility.
